Rich castle-building heritage

Castles in Germany originate from the ninth to the tenth centuries, while they evolved in medieval times, throughout the fall of Ancient Rome and in the beginning of the Renaissance. In total, Germany is home to around 12,000 castles that are either still standing or in ruins. No wonder then, that there are castles to suit every interest – and not just for romantics. After all, castles in Germany range from medieval fairy-tale sites and fantasy palaces to remnants of old fortresses, and they greatly vary in architecture and design, which can be explained by the varieties of traditions and cultures throughout German history.

Visitors to these castles can look forward to impressive histories to be discovered behind the doorways. After all, only around 100 years ago, kings, emperors and their families still lived there. Today, these spectacular buildings serve as cultural objects, guesthouses and museums.
